Comment from highflyer74
Hello and thanks for your reply!
"if they are primary, it allows truckers in winter to make it easier to get goods to needed communities"
This to me is an indication that you have not yet understood how OSM works. It is completely irrelevant if they are tagged =primary. This does not improve anything routing wise. What you are looking for is another look on the map, and that is not what we want (https://wiki.openstreetmap.org/wiki/Good_practice#Don't_map_for_the_renderer).
Base your mapping on knowledge, otherwise you will decrease the quality of OSM data. Editing the whole planet without knowledge of local stuff is not helping a lot. Why don't you try to get in touch with your local community and help them to improve your home area?
Besides that: changing your username every couple of days does not make you appear professional.
If you really want to help the project, take it slow, try to be precise (e.g. a building=* is a building, not a whole area of buildings).
If not, please stay away.
Thank you!
